Job description

Overview

Imagine your ideal job. Now add bowling, arcade games, amazing parties, and delicious food. Our Kitchen Managers combine their natural culinary ability with exceptional management skills. They’re the guardians of our Food & Beverage program, bringing our nationally recognized menus to life, keeping standards high, and managing their kitchens efficiently.

Essential Duties

Embrace the Menu

  • Adhere to the company’s mandated F&B menu and purchasing programs

Keep an Eye on the Numbers

  • Maintain budgeted revenue, costs of sales, labor, supplies, as well as operating cash flow as it relates to food operations; review monthly profit & loss statements and make adjustments as necessary

Get the Party Started

  • Work with the Operations team and Sales staff to plan, supervise, and execute for all events, supervising the preparation and service of all food and beverage (in addition to cleanup); assist with cooking when needed

Plan Like a Pro

  • Estimate food consumption and make purchases as appropriate from our specified food program; schedule staff efficiently to accommodate shifts in business volume

Assemble an All‑Star Team

  • Work with the center’s management to recruit, hire, train, and retain a rock star kitchen staff

Commit to Quality

  • Ensure that our product quality, freshness, and presentation are always at company standard; supervise and oversee the preparation, portioning, garnishing, and storage of all food

Keep it Clean

  • Facilitate and manage all kitchen equipment maintenance and implement/conduct sanitation audits and cleaning schedules in order to comply with all local Department of Health (DOH) regulations.
Who You Are

You’re an experienced Kitchen Manager with a highly developed sense of customer service, great interpersonal/communication skills, and a high-level of profit and loss capability. You take accountability for your team (like any great leader) and your organizational skills are second to none. Our centers are fast‑paced, high‑volume retail environments that are as demanding to work in as they are rewarding. You’ll be leading a team of lead cooks, cooks, dishwashers, and servers, and will report to and support your center’s General Manager on all matters food‑related. Experience prepping catered events or presenting food for other special events is desirable, but not essential.

Desired Skills
  • 3+ Years of Kitchen Management Experience
  • Bachelor’s or culinary degree preferred
  • Experience in high‑volume retail, entertainment, hospitality, or restaurant venue required
  • Experience preparing banquet style events
  • Current ServSafe certification is required
  • ServSafe instructor certification or ability to be certified is preferred
Work Environment / Physical Demands
  • Typical entertainment environment where you will walk, bend, and stand for periods of time, and may lift objects with some assistance.

The pay range for this position is $50,000 to $60,000 per year.

Lucky Strike Entertainment offers performance‑based incentives and a competitive total rewards package which includes healthcare coverage and a broad range of other benefits.
